I've used a Gray-Nicolls Evo 5 star for 3 seasons now and to be fair it has been the best bat I've ever had, but like all things it's getting old. I've had it referbed twice but I'm looking to get something new for next season and was wondering what you guys would recommend.
I like a light bat with a mid sweetspot and quite a traditional shape with a slight bow.
I was wondering whether to go 'off the shelf' with something like a GM Halo or a GN Maverick or to go down the custom made route?
I am looking to spend around £125-£175
Any advice you guys have to offer would be gratefully recieved.
